The corner unit needs two end sections for it to stand up stable, just pick the ones you prefer from the modular collection and on the underside of the corner section you attach 4 L shape brackets that screw the whole lot together, its easy enough to do mate however you will need an extra pair of hand to hold it in position whilst you screw the brackets on its abit fiddly :P

The drawers have pre drilled holes in so the back supports on the corner unit simply screw into the side drawers with the screws provided, its a breeze to do mate as long as you have a friend to help hold it in place whilst you use the screwdriver :) The underside of the corner unit does not have pre drilled holes for screws when you come to attach the L shape brackets so screwing them on is abit harder.
